This molecular alignment allows light to pass through and gives the shatter its brittleness. In shatter, the bricks all stack nice and neat, one on top of the other, as if you had just built a wall. To put it in more relatable terms, think about the molecules in the concentrate (the amber liquid before it cools) as Lego bricks. Shatter’s transparent quality results from the temperatures used during the extraction and finishing process (as well as other variables) and can only be described by some pretty heavy chemical jargon. The result of these efforts is an amber liquid that, once cooled, solidifies into a final product that often has the consistency of thin peanut brittle. Professionals and adventurous DIYers make concentrates by “soaking” cannabis material in various solvents, such as: Shatter is a translucent - sometimes transparent - concentrate that looks an awful lot like rock candy or a Jolly Rancher.
